Folic Acid and vitamin B 12 are important for:
The U.S. Public Health Service recommends all women of childbearing age consume folic acid daily.
Folic acid plays a vital role in infant development at time of conception; regular intake of folic acid before becoming pregnant is important. Folic acid is involved with DNA synthesis and other metabolic tasks.
Having too little folic acid is associated with a type of anemia, adversely affecting blood cell formation and function.
Individuals with too little folic acid tend to have lower moods. Having adequate folic acid levels has been shown to improve one’s response to mood medications, providing useful nutrition support.
Folic acid supports heart and circulatory health*.
Vitamin B-12 (methylcobalamin) supports utilization and works in tandem with folic acid.
Folic acid and vitamin B-12 are B-vitamins. They are water-soluble, not stored in the body and must be replaced on a regular basis to maintain healthy levels. They are destroyed in food by heat, cooking and light.
